1955 Ford Crestline 1988 Jaguar XJS
Make Ford Jaguar
Model Crestline XJS
Year Released 1955 1988
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 4453 cc 3590 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 0 HP 217 HP
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Vehicle Weight 1510 kg 1630 kg
Vehicle Length 5030 mm 4880 mm
Vehicle Width 1890 mm 1800 mm
Wheelbase Size 2940 mm 2600 mm
